BM2P104H-Z Description
The BM2P104H-Z is a high-performance DC switching voltage regulator designed by ROHM Semiconductor. This device is specifically tailored for applications requiring efficient power conversion and stable output voltage. The BM2P104H-Z operates within a wide input voltage range of 10.9V to 30V, making it suitable for various power supply scenarios. It delivers a robust 4A output current, ensuring reliable power delivery to demanding loads. The regulator employs a flyback topology, which is known for its simplicity and efficiency in isolated power conversion applications. The switching frequency is set at 100kHz, balancing efficiency and component size requirements.
The BM2P104H-Z is housed in a 7DIP package, which is available in a tube packaging format, facilitating easy handling and integration into through-hole mounting designs. This regulator is REACH unaffected and ROHS3 compliant, ensuring environmental safety and regulatory adherence. It also has a moisture sensitivity level (MSL) of 3, allowing for a 168-hour exposure period, which is advantageous for manufacturing processes involving reflow soldering.
